热门关键词:
                                  当前位置:主页 > web3.0 >

                                  区块链币的算法解析:基础概念与应用案例

                                  时间:2025-04-22 00:42:36 来源:未知 点击:

                                  在数字货币和区块链技术蓬勃发展的当今社会,了解区块链币的算法具有至关重要的意义。这些算法不仅决定了货币的安全性和交易的效率,也是推动区块链技术创新的重要动力。本文将详细探讨区块链币的算法,涵盖其工作原理、种类、应用及相关问题解答,帮助读者深入理解这个前沿领域。

                                  区块链算法的基本概念

                                  区块链的核心在于它是一种去中心化的分布式账本技术。在这一系统中,所有的交易信息都被记录在一个连续的区块链上,而这些信息是通过特定的算法进行验证和保护的。区块链币的算法主要分为两种:工作量证明(PoW)和权益证明(PoS)。

                                  工作量证明算法要求矿工通过计算复杂的数学问题来获得区块奖励。以比特币为例,矿工需要通过大量的计算找到一个合适的哈希值,这个过程被称为“挖矿”。然而,随着时间的推移,挖矿的难度越来越大,且对计算资源的需求也越来越高。

                                  相对而言,权益证明算法则是通过持币者的持有量来确定其参与验证交易的权利。持币者越多,获得的奖励也越大。这种方式不仅消耗更少的能源,还能更快地确认交易,从而提升系统的效率。

                                  区块链币的主要算法类型

                                  区块链币的算法解析:基础概念与应用案例

                                  除了PoW和PoS,区块链领域还有许多其他类型的算法,各具特点和优缺点。

                                  1. **授权证明(DPoS)**:这是对权益证明的进一步发展,允许持币者投票选择代表,负责验证交易。这种方法显著提高了网络的速度和效率,但也可能导致中心化问题。

                                  2. **工作量证明与权益证明结合(Hybrid PoW/PoS)**:一些加密货币结合了这两种交易验证方式,以期取长补短。这类币的参与者既可以通过挖矿(PoW)获得奖励,也可以通过持币(PoS)来获得收益。

                                  3. **链上量化算法(On-chain Governance)**:这种算法允许社区成员直接参与协议的升级与决策,增强了去中心化的属性。它适用于那些想要促进社区决策能力的区块链项目。

                                  这些算法在不同的区块链项目中有着各自独特的意义与作用,而选择合适的算法又是作为开发者或投资者必须考虑的关键因素。

                                  区块链币算法的应用案例

                                  不同的区块链币根据其背后所使用的算法展现了不同的市场特征和应用场景。这些应用案例为我们理解算法在实际中的重要性提供了生动的示范。

                                  1. **比特币(Bitcoin)**:比特币是第一个应用工作量证明算法的加密货币,其成功在于实施了一个透明且可追溯的分布式账本。矿工们通过不断的计算来验证交易,确保网络的安全性。

                                  2. **以太坊(Ethereum)**:以太坊则是在智能合约的基础上建立的,最初是基于PoW算法,但目前正向PoS过渡。以太坊的这种转变旨在提高交易速度,减少对电力的消耗,并推动生态系统的可持续发展。

                                  3. **波场(TRON)**:波场采用了DPoS算法,旨在让用户通过投票选择超级代表。这种机制不仅提高了交易的确认速度,而且增强了社区参与度,促进了去中心化。

                                  常见问题解答

                                  区块链币的算法解析:基础概念与应用案例

                                  区块链币的算法如何影响交易安全性?

                                  区块链币的算法直接影响到交易的安全性,尤其是如何防范双重支付和网络攻击。工作量证明算法通过强大的计算能力和高昂的成本有效地保障了交易的安全。

                                  在PoW机制下,矿工需要投入大量的计算资源空气来解决复杂的数学问题。这意味着,任何想要操纵网络的攻击者都需要占有超过51%的计算能力,这在技术上是相当困难和昂贵的。因此,PoW网络能够维持较高的安全性。

                                  然而,PoW也并非没有缺点,尤其是在资源消耗方面。而PoS则通过持币者的持有量进行验证,虽然减少了能源消耗,但可能会面对“富者愈富”的问题。如果一个持币者拥有大量的货币,他想要控制网络的可能性相对较高。

                                  此外,许多新颖的算法,如DPoS和链上治理,也在寻求通过去中心化投票机制来加强网络的安全性。总体而言,算法的选择直接关系到整个区块链系统的安全框架。

                                  为什么选择不同类型的算法会影响区块链的可扩展性?

                                  区块链的可扩展性是指其在交易量增加的情况下,依然能够快速响应并处理大量交易的能力。算法的选择在这方面扮演着决定性角色。

                                  以PoW为例,它虽然在安全性上表现优异,但由于每个区块的生成速度相对较慢,因此交易响应时间较长,导致可扩展性不足。尤其是在网络高峰期,交易费用可能会大幅上涨。

                                  相反,PoS和DPoS算法通过减少验证交易所需的时间,实现在短时间内处理更多交易,有效提升了可扩展性。此外,通过采用分片技术和状态通道等新兴技术,多种加速算法也为解决可扩展性问题提供了可行方案。

                                  可扩展性问题是区块链技术能够快速广泛应用的重要考量。因此,选择合适的算法至关重要,开发者必须根据项目需求和市场情况作出判断。

                                  如何评估区块链币的算法及其经济模型?

                                  评估区块链币的算法及其经济模型涉及多个方面,包括技术、市场、社区等。首先,了解其背后所采用的算法至关重要,因为这一点会影响网络的安全性、效率及其经济模型的运行方式。

                                  其次,观察其经济模型的设计——例如通货膨胀率、矿工奖励、权益分配等因素。这些策略影响着投资者和用户的参与意愿。一个合理的经济模型能够吸引更多用户进场,也能激励生态系统的健康运转。

                                  此外,查看其社区支持度也是评估的重要依据。社区的活跃程度、开发者的参与度以及合规性问题都是考虑的方向。可持续的项目通常拥有一个忠实的社区支持,才能在竞争激烈的市场中立足。

                                  未来区块链币算法的发展趋势是什么?

                                  随着技术的不断进步,区块链币算法的发展也在不断演变。未来,可能会出现以下几种趋势:

                                  1. **绿色算法**:响应全球对环保的重视,区块链项目将更倾向于采用低能耗的算法,如PoS和DPoS,以降低环境影响。

                                  2. **多元化算法**:结合多种算法的项目将会越来越多,例如混合模型将有助于提升安全性和效率。

                                  3. **可编程算法**:智能合约的不断发展,也在推动区块链算法变得更灵活、可编程,为开发者提供更大的自由度。

                                  4. **社区主导的治理**:链上治理机制将大行其道,参与者将通过投票机制对协议升级、参数调整进行参与,使得平台更具去中心化特性。

                                  总之,区块链币的算法是一项复杂而动态的领域,涵盖技术、经济和社会多个层面。理解这些算法的工作机理及其潜在影响,能够帮助用户和投资者做出更为明智的决策。